THET WALK-IN, 9PM, ITV

WRITTEN by the Oscarnominated and BAFTAwinning screenwriter Jeff Pope (A Confession, Philomena, Little Boy Blue), this gripping five-part drama is the true story of how a neo-Nazi plan to kill an MP was foiled f by an inside man. It begins in 2016 in the months leading up to the Brexit vote, when Britain was more divided than ever and immigration was the hot topic of the day. The brilliant Stephen Graham (pictured) gives a typically convincing performance as activist Matthew Collins, a reformed neo-Nazi now working as a journalist for the antiracist organisation Hope Not Hate, who specialises in infiltrating

far-Right groups with inside moles — or walk-ins — with the goal of publishing information about their activities online. After the horrific murder of MP Jo Cox by a white supremacist, Collins became even more determined to infiltrate one particularly dangerous group, National Action, but with no success. That was until one day in March 2017, when he received an email from a member of the group who revealed details of a plan to kill a second MP, and the men worked together to prevent this hideous crime. The whole of this slow-burning series will be available as a box set on ITV Hub after the first episode has aired.
